The fluffyness of pancakes is caused by baking soda reacting to an acid when liquid or acid liquid such as buttermilk is added (baking powder is basically baking soda and creme of tartar which is a dry acid.) it's the same reaction that works on any. Frozen pancake batter will last for up to one month without the taste or texture being altered, but is safe to eat for up to three months after being stored in the freezer.
